The Enduring Character, Size and Potential of "Rosemore".

'Rosemore', Harden has definitely seen better days, however it's immense character, size & potential will captivate you.
An intriguing 'Victorian style' circa. 1881 double brick offering a surprising 4 bedrooms and 1 bathroom that's ripe for renovation.
Features high pressed metal ceilings, original fireplaces, slow combustion stove, split sytem A/C & traditional verandahs.
Its classic, rambling floor plan comprises formal lounge & dining rooms, electric kitchen and sunroom & laundry / toilet.
Positioned on a massive approx. 1,498sqm's with dual street & laneway frontage, set in off the Burley Griffin Way thoroughfare.
Despite its existing, longstanding residential use, prospective buyers should note the property's E3 Productivity Support zoning.
Out the back there is a double carport, old outer-building improvements which complement and extensive pet enclosures.
The sheer character, size and potential of 'Rosemore' will coax buyers who will appreciate the property's 'Heritage Significance'.

About Harden 2587

The size of Harden is approximately 29.2 square kilometres. It has 1 park covering nearly 1.3% of total area. The population of Harden in 2016 was 2030 people. By 2021 the population was 1900 showing a population decline of 6.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Harden is 70-79 years. Households in Harden are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Harden work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 76.10% of the homes in Harden were owner-occupied compared with 74.30% in 2016.

Harden has 1,313 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Harden have seen a 63.81%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 41.22%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Harden is $344,768 while the median value for Units is $423,040.
  • Houses have a median rent of $425.
There are currently 8 properties listed for sale, and 1 property listed for rent in Harden on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 41 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Harden.
